The Court adopts the R&R in whole and writes only to clarify one portion 17 of the R&R. 18 One possible reading of the R&R is that to the extent Plaintiff made claims under 42 19 U.S.C. § 1983 those claims are subject to Washington’s claim filing statute, RCW 4.92.110, and 20 are barred by Plaintiff’s failure to file a claim prior to pursuing this action. See Dkt. #25 at 4 (not 21 specifying whether discussion applies to all claims or only to state law claims). The Court does 22 not read the R&R as reaching that conclusion because § 1983 claims are not subject to the claim 23 filing statute. See Joshua v. Newell, 871 F.2d 884, 886 (9th Cir. 1989) (“We hold that the 24 Washington notice of claims statute does not apply to section 1983 claims brought in federal 1 court.”). Accordingly, Plaintiff’s failure to comply with the claim filing statute bars only his 2 state law claims and not potential § 1983 claims. Regardless, any § 1983 claims are barred by 3 the Eleventh Amendment for the reasons laid out in the R&R and summary judgment is 4 appropriate on that basis. 5 Having made this clarification and having reviewed the R&R and the remainder of the 6 record, the Court finds and ORDERS: 7 1.
